EvinceはリモートコンピュータからSSH経由でX11接続を確立できません。

EvinceはリモートコンピュータからSSH経由でX11接続を確立できません。

リモートシステムにログインを使用するssh -X remote_machine -l userと起動できないようですevince

user@remote_machine:~$ evince
X11 connection rejected because of wrong authentication.

** (evince:2040): WARNING **: Could not open X display
X11 connection rejected because of wrong authentication.
X11 connection rejected because of wrong authentication.
Cannot parse arguments: Cannot open display: 

これは唯一のGUIアプリケーションです。nautiluskateまたは問題なく実行され、geditローカルfirefoxコンピューターに正しく表示されます。

この問題を解決するために削除して~/.Xauthority再接続しましたが、役に立ちませんでした。 .pdfファイルを開いてみましたが、nautilus同じエラーメッセージが表示されました。環境DISPLAY変数は次のように設定されます。

user@remote_machine:~$ env | grep DISPLAY
DISPLAY=localhost:10.0

これevince自体がバグかもしれませんか?

ベストアンサー1

-X が動作しない場合もあります。 -Yを試してください。

ssh -Y  user@remote_machine

おすすめ記事